Proverbs 29:2-11 English Standard Version (ESV)

2. When the righteous increase, the people rejoice,but when the wicked rule, the people groan.

3. He who loves wisdom makes his father glad,but a companion of prostitutes squanders his wealth.

4. By justice a king builds up the land,but he who exacts gifts tears it down.

5. A man who flatters his neighborspreads a net for his feet.

6. An evil man is ensnared in his transgression,but a righteous man sings and rejoices.

7. A righteous man knows the rights of the poor;a wicked man does not understand such knowledge.

8. Scoffers set a city aflame,but the wise turn away wrath.

9. If a wise man has an argument with a fool,the fool only rages and laughs, and there is no quiet.

10. Bloodthirsty men hate one who is blamelessand seek the life of the upright.

11. A fool gives full vent to his spirit,but a wise man quietly holds it back.
